jQuery实现拖拽替换效果的教程与代码示例

版权申诉
0 下载量 161 浏览量 更新于2024-10-23 收藏 130KB ZIP 举报
资源摘要信息: "jQuery拖拽替换效果.zip" 知识点: 1. jQuery简介: jQuery是一个快速、小巧、功能丰富的JavaScript库。它通过简化HTML文档遍历、事件处理、动画以及Ajax交互等操作,让Web开发变得更加简单。jQuery库使用选择器和封装好的函数,使得开发者能够以更少的代码完成复杂的操作。该库广泛用于网页特效、网站前端开发、移动应用开发等场景。 2. 拖拽(Drag and Drop)功能: 拖拽功能允许用户通过鼠标拖动一个元素到指定区域,并在拖动结束时执行相应的动作。在Web开发中,拖拽通常与HTML5的拖放API或jQuery的拖放插件结合使用,以实现元素之间的交互。拖拽功能在许多应用中都非常实用,比如拼图游戏、文件上传界面、在线购物车等。 3. 替换效果的实现: 在Web开发中,替换效果可以指很多不同的视觉效果。但通常它指的是在用户进行某种操作(如点击、拖动)后,页面上的某个元素被另一个元素替换或更新的过程。这可以增加用户交互的趣味性和页面的动态性,常见的例子有卡片交换、图片轮播、布局切换等。 4. 使用jQuery实现拖拽替换效果: 使用jQuery来实现拖拽替换效果,通常需要利用到jQuery UI库。jQuery UI是jQuery的一个官方扩展,它提供了一套用户界面交互的控件和效果。在拖拽替换效果中,我们可能会使用到以下组件和方法: - `.draggable()`:使元素可被拖动。 - `.droppable()`:使元素可以接受拖放的元素。 - `.replaceWith()` 或 `.html()`:在拖放动作完成后,用来替换元素内容的方法。 - `.effect()` 或 `.animate()`:用于实现元素替换时的动画效果。 5. forgetxbl与tidewad: 这两个标签可能是特定项目、库或者技术的名称,但在通用的IT知识中并没有明确的定义。它们可能是特定于某个项目或个人自定义的标识符,用于组织或标记特定功能、模块或代码段。 6. web开发: Web开发涉及创建和维护网站或Web应用程序。它通常包括前端开发(客户端)和后端开发(服务器端)两个部分。前端开发主要负责用户界面与用户体验,使用HTML、CSS和JavaScript等技术,而jQuery正是JavaScript库的一种。后端开发负责服务器、应用和数据库之间的交互,使用如PHP、Python、Java等语言。 7. HTML5拖放API与jQuery拖放: 虽然HTML5原生提供了拖放API,允许开发者直接使用JavaScript实现拖放功能,但jQuery通过其插件和封装的API,提供了一种更为简便和跨浏览器的解决方案。jQuery的拖放操作更加直观,并且能够与现有的jQuery代码库更紧密地集成。 综上所述,"jQuery拖拽替换效果.zip"文件很可能包含了实现拖拽替换效果的示例代码、教程或插件。开发者可以利用这些资源快速掌握如何在Web项目中添加拖拽替换功能,以提升网站的用户体验和交互性。